What Is a Foot and Ankle Joint Specialist?

A foot and ankle joint specialist is a health care expert qualified especially to detect, deal with, and avoid conditions that influence the reduced limbs-- especially the feet and ankle joints. These experts are typically podiatrists or orthopedic professionals with innovative training in musculoskeletal issues.

They treat a wide range of conditions, consisting of:

    Plantar fasciitis Achilles tendonitis Ankle sprains and fractures Bunions and hammertoes Flat feet and high arches Arthritis of the foot or ankle Sports injuries and overuse issues Nerve pain, such as tarsal tunnel syndrome

Their deep understanding of biomechanics allows them to customize therapies for each and every person, assisting to recover function and ease pain better than family doctors might.

Why Specialized Foot Care Matters

Feet and ankles are complicated structures, made up of 26 bones, 33 joints, and over 100 muscles, ligaments, and tendons. They sustain body weight, take in shock, and enable movement. Any little misalignment or injury can impact the entire body-- from the knees to the back.

That's why a foot and ankle joint specialist can make such a significant difference. By zeroing in on the root of the issue, instead of simply treating signs, they use lasting services. Whether someone is managing persistent foot pain or has experienced a sports-related injury, specialized therapy brings about faster healing and much better outcomes.

When to See a Foot and Ankle Specialist

Many individuals wait as well lengthy to look for specialist treatment, presuming that discomfort will certainly vanish on its own. Nonetheless, the faster treatment is gotten, the much better the prognosis. Right here are common indications that a see to a professional may be essential:

    Persistent foot or ankle pain lasting more than a week Swelling that does not go down with rest and ice Pain when strolling or birthing weight Deformities such as bunions or hammertoes Difficulty wearing normal shoes Numbness or prickling in the feet Recurring ankle joint sprains

Ignoring these signs might result in complications that need even more intrusive treatment in the future.

Common Treatments Offered

Foot and ankle specialists use a variety of devices and techniques to detect and deal with conditions. Depending upon the concern, a client might get:

    Physical therapy Custom orthotics or braces Cortisone injections Shockwave therapy Minor medical procedures Preventative care and gait analysis

For those with more serious injuries, experts may also carry out cosmetic surgery or describe additional support solutions such as sporting activities medicine or rehabilitation.
